Evolution of Internet Poker Tournaments
Internet poker tournaments surfaced inside belated 1990s as internet-based poker rooms began to gain grip. Web sites like Planet Poker and Paradise Poker pioneered the idea of virtual poker tournaments. However, limited technology and connection posed difficulties, causing a somewhat crude video gaming knowledge.

Over time, advancements in computer software technology and net infrastructure significantly enhanced the internet poker competition experience. User-friendly interfaces, enhanced graphics, and advanced formulas changed virtual poker into a high-quality, realistic experience. The availability of secure transaction methods also boosted the self-confidence of individuals, attracting a more substantial player base.

Popularity and Growth
Internet poker tournaments have actually attained colossal popularity recently. The convenience aspect, with people having the ability to contend from the absolute comfort of their domiciles, contributed notably to its development. The vast choice of tournaments, differing in structure, buy-ins, and prize pools, draws both amateur and expert people.

Also, the proliferation of reputable online poker platforms created a feeling of trust among players. Web sites like PokerStars, 888poker, and PartyPoker spent greatly in ads and sponsorships, solidifying their place as marketplace frontrunners. Big-name players, including Daniel Negreanu and Phil Ivey, also endorsed on-line poker tournaments, adding to their particular credibility.
